ELECTIONS IN GREECE

POLL-PROCEEDS QUIETLY

PEAR OF LATER COUP

VENIZELISTS' PLANS

(Elec. Tel. Copyright—United Press Assn.)

(Reed. Jan. 27, 11 a.m.)

ATHENS, Jan. 26

The country is polling peacefully. The main contest i,s between the Popular Party, headed by M. Tsaldaris, and the Venizelos Party, headed by M. iSophoulos.

None of the late Ministers are con testing seats. A heavy. poll is iridi cated.

Officers supporting u.c Venizclists and General Kondylis are believed to be eager to seize power if the elections are unfavourable to them. Troops are ready to quell any outbreak.
